Attire and Packing Tips

When traveling to Vienna in November, it’s essential to pack attire that suits the prevailing weather conditions. Since temperatures can vary significantly between daytime and evening, layering your clothing is recommended. This allows you to adjust to the changing weather throughout the day.

Be sure to include warm clothing in your packing list, such as sweaters, jackets, and long-sleeved shirts. Additionally, don’t forget to pack waterproof outerwear, as there may be occasional rainfall. Comfortable shoes suitable for long walks are also a must, as Vienna offers many enchanting parks and gardens to explore during this time of year.

Seasonal Delights

As temperatures cool down, Vienna provides its residents and visitors with culinary delights that warm both the body and soul. Indulge in traditional Viennese dishes that are perfect for autumn and winter, such as hearty stews, comforting soups, or flavorful dumplings. These savory recipes will satisfy your taste buds and provide a sense of coziness amid the chilly weather.

Vienna is also known for its coffee culture, and November is an excellent time to savor the city’s specialty coffee variations. Whether you prefer a rich Melange, a comforting Einspänner, or a decadent Viennese hot chocolate, the cozy coffeehouses of Vienna are ready to serve you a warm cup of bliss.

For those seeking a bit of indulgence and a taste of the holiday spirit, mulled wine is a seasonal treat that you can find at Vienna’s Christmas markets, adding warmth and cheerfulness to your November experience.
